fix missing self in SubprocSpec repr

This commit is contained in:
Gil Forsyth 2016-10-27 15:31:53 -04:00
parent 9d0fd25b40
commit f6b14ae090

View file

@ -426,13 +426,13 @@ class SubprocSpec:
self.captured_stderr = None self.captured_stderr = None
def __str__(self): def __str__(self):
s = self.cls.__name__ + '(' + str(cmd) + ', ' s = self.cls.__name__ + '(' + str(self.cmd) + ', '
kws = [n + '=' + str(getattr(self, n)) for n in self.kwnames] kws = [n + '=' + str(getattr(self, n)) for n in self.kwnames]
s += ', '.join(kws) + ')' s += ', '.join(kws) + ')'
return s return s
def __repr__(self): def __repr__(self):
s = self.__class__.__name__ + '(' + repr(cmd) + ', ' s = self.__class__.__name__ + '(' + repr(self.cmd) + ', '
s += self.cls.__name__ + ', ' s += self.cls.__name__ + ', '
kws = [n + '=' + repr(getattr(self, n)) for n in self.kwnames] kws = [n + '=' + repr(getattr(self, n)) for n in self.kwnames]
s += ', '.join(kws) + ')' s += ', '.join(kws) + ')'